In onderstaande tabel hebben we een aantal open source en commerciële Model Based Testing tools opgenomen die het MBT proces kunnen ondersteunen. De lijst is zeer zeker niet volledig. Het geeft een indicatie van de vele mogelijkheden die er zijn.
In de tabel vind je de naam van de tool (inclusief link naar de website voor meer informatie), het ondersteunde input formaat, licentie type en een korte beschrijving.
Naam | Input formaat | Soort licentie | Korte beschrijving |
---|---|---|---|
4Test | Custom (Gherkin based) | Commercieel | 4Test is een MBT tool waarbij de test ontwerpmethode Constraint Driven Testing (CDT) en de test automatisering methode Keyword Driven API Testing (KDAT) zijn gecombineerd. |
BPM-X | BPMN, UML, flowcharts, etc. | Commercieel | BPM-X maakt testgevallen van business process-modellen die o.a gemaakt zijn met OpenText® ProVision, ARIS®, Sparx Enterprise Architect, CaseWise, MEGA, IBM Rational® System Architect en Microsoft Visio®. Het kan testgevallen exporteren naar Excel, HP Quality Center, SAP® of eCATT. |
Conformiq Creator | Activity Diagrams, DSL, Gherkin, BPM, flowcharts, etc | Commercieel | Creator maakt testgevallen van business process-modellen die of gemaakt worden met de tooling of worden geïmporteerd uit Microsoft Visio®, ARIS®, en andere BPM tools, plus XSD en WSDL structuren. Daarnaast kunnen QTP en Selenium tests worden geïmporteerd. |
DTM | Custom activity model | Commercieel | Met DTM kun je een testmodel maken en op basis van dit testmodel kunnen er testgevallen worden gegenereerd. Deze testgevallen worden gegenereerd op basis van een algoritme die combination coverage wordt genoemd. |
fMBT | Custom (AAL) | Open Source | Met fMBT kun je een testmodel opstellen en de testgevallen automatisch laten genereren. fMBT heeft een model editor, testgenerator en kan interfacen met verschillende tools voor het analyseren van logs. |
GraphWalker | FSM | Open Source | Met GraphWalker kunnen testgevallen worden gegenereerd op basis van Finite State Machines. |
MBTsuite | UML of BPMN | Commercieel | Met MBTsuite kunnen testgevallen worden gegenereerd op basis van UML modellen. MBTsuite heeft interfaces met verschillende testmanagement en testuitvoerings tools. |
A
Ook interessant?
![Model Based Testen](https://www.toets-je-parate-kennis-over.nl/software-testen/wp-content/uploads/sites/3/2017/03/Model-based-testen-200x200.jpg)
Wat is Model Based Testing (MBT)?
Voordat we ingaan op model based testing (MBT), gaan we eerst in op wat een model is. Wat is een ...
![Model Based Testen](https://www.toets-je-parate-kennis-over.nl/software-testen/wp-content/uploads/sites/3/2017/03/Model-based-testen-200x200.jpg)
Stappen binnen Model Based Testing proces
De mogelijke stappen binnen het Model Based Testing proces zijn weergegeven in onderstaand figuur. Afhankelijk van de gebruikte tooling kunnen ...
![Tools Model Based Testen](https://www.toets-je-parate-kennis-over.nl/software-testen/wp-content/uploads/sites/3/2017/03/Tools-Model-Based-Testen-200x200.jpg)
Tools voor Model Based Testing
In onderstaande tabel hebben we een aantal open source en commerciële Model Based Testing tools opgenomen die het MBT proces ...
![Selenium Suite](https://www.toets-je-parate-kennis-over.nl/software-testen/wp-content/uploads/sites/3/2017/02/Overzichtsplaatje-selenium-suite-200x200.jpg)
Selenium Suite
We hebben een aantal onderwerpen over Selenium Suite opgenomen:
- Wat is Selenium Suite?
- De voordelen en nadelen van de ...